3Com Switch 5500/5500G Family
3Com’s 5500/5500G products provide port density and performance comparable to the stackable switch specifications for competitive products. With reasonable, but not leading edge pricing and a good warranty, 3Com is maintaining its market momentum. (2/8/2010)
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ch 6850 Series
The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ch 6850 family of stackable fixed switches remains a competitive offering with PoE, 10G uplinks, strong security and software upgrade features that provide good investment protection. (7/13/2009)
Cisco Catalyst 3750/3750-E Series
Cisco’s Catalyst 3750/3750-E is very threatening to competitors because of its unmatched investment protection, strong performance, and strong model diversity. (12/5/2008)
Enterasys SecureStack C-Series
Enterasys’s SecureStack C-Series is threatening to competitors because of its strong port diversity, 10GbE support and the focus on security that Enterasys brings to all of its switching products. (7/23/2009)
Extreme Networks Summit X450e/X450a Series
Extreme’s Summit X450e/X450a series provides a competitive aggregation and small core switch due to good performance and reasonable port diversity. With PoE capabilities, the X450e can support handsets, access points, and other PoE devices. (8/3/2009)
Force10 S-Series
The Force10 S-Series offers good 10G Ethernet and PoE options, making this product competitive in the fixed and stackable switch market. (7/30/2009)
HP ProCurve Networking ProCurve Switch 3400cl Series
The ProCurve 3400cl line of fixed switches is vulnerable to competitors because, despite its ability to put pressure on the market with its pricing and lifetime warranty, it still lacks dedicated stacking and port diversity in the product line. (12/5/2008)
Nortel Ethernet Routing Switch 5000 Series
Nortel’s ERS 5500 series of fixed configuration switches are competitive due to its strong feature set and Nortel’s strong protocols such as DMLT and MLT. (12/5/2008)
